Application window opens for UK-Nigeria Tech Hub’s iNOVO Accelerator

The UK-Nigeria tech hub has partnered in a startup bootcamp with AfriTech and Venture platform to launch the new iNOVO Accelerator.

The program will narrow on startups fixated on education, health, and agriculture while offering disruptive solutions to the underlying problems experienced with the Covid-19 pandemic. The iNOVO accelerator program will run for 3 months utilizing Startupbootcamp’s methodology of a 2 pronged approach in the acceleration of 10 Nigerian early-stage startups that solve pandemic related programmes and challenges while giving over 100 startups a new lifeline of learning access to its digital Accelerator Squared platform. Teams that participate will get the opportunity to validate their solutions through pilots and proof of concept engagements.

During the launch, Honey Ogundeyi, Country Director at Nigeria-UK Tech Hub pointed out the impact of Covid-19 on the economy and the “need to support” innovative early-stage startups with innovative solutions.

Benefits to the iNOVO Accelerator programme

  • Capacity building
  • Lean training for startups
  • Mentorship from entrepreneurs and industry experts
  • Scaling of products and business models
  • Opportunities for networking
  • Skills enhancement

During the collaboration, Director of Programs at Ventures Platform Foundation, Mohamed Felata, expressed her delight in the partnership while pointing out the growth support it offers to talented founders.

Philip Kiracofe, the Chief Executive Officer at  Startupbootcamp AfriTech, pointed out how leading global banks are backing the accelerator program. He called for more African leaders to take part in the iNOVO program.
